Psychoactive drug
A psychoactive drug or psychotropic substance is a chemical substance that acts primarily upon the central nervous system where it alters brain function, resulting in temporary changes in perceptionmoodconsciousness and behavior. These drugs may be used recreationally to purposefully alter one's consciousness, as entheogens for ritual or spiritual purposes, or therapeutically as medication.

psychoactive drug
Noun
1. a drug that can produce mood changes and distorted perceptions
(synonym) mind-altering drug, consciousness-altering drug, psychoactive substance
(hypernym) drug
(hyponym) designer drug
